
CAS 881415-04-9
:3-Fluoro-2-methyl-6-nitro-benzoic acid methyl ester
Description:
3-Fluoro-2-methyl-6-nitro-benzoic acid methyl ester is an organic compound characterized by its functional groups and structural features. It contains a benzoic acid moiety with a methyl ester group, which enhances its solubility in organic solvents. The presence of a nitro group and a fluorine atom on the aromatic ring contributes to its reactivity and potential applications in various chemical reactions, including electrophilic substitution. The methyl ester functional group typically makes the compound less acidic compared to its carboxylic acid counterpart, while the nitro group can serve as a strong electron-withdrawing group, influencing the compound's electronic properties. This compound may be utilized in pharmaceutical research, agrochemicals, or as an intermediate in organic synthesis due to its unique structural attributes. Additionally, its specific molecular interactions can be explored in the context of drug design or material science. Safety and handling precautions should be observed, as with all chemical substances, due to potential toxicity or reactivity.
Formula:C9H8FNO4
